DCI Names Fankhauser as First Female President of Core Bank Tech Provider

HUTCHINSON, KAN., April 17, 2020 – Data Center Inc. (DCI), the privately-owned developer of iCore360® core banking software and related digital technologies for community financial institutions nationwide, today announced the election of Sarah Fankhauser to President and COO by the company’s board of directors.

DCI Acquires Vetter from AFT Analytics

HUTCHINSON, KAN., April 14, 2020 – Data Center Inc. (DCI), the privately-owned developer of the iCore360® bank management software and related technologies for community financial institutions, announced today their acquisition of the Vetter technology suite, a product offering of AFT Analytics Inc., in New York, NY.
